The world of radio was forever changed with the invention of Lee De Forest’s audion tube. This groundbreaking device, invented in 1906, paved the way for modern radio as we know it today.

At its core, the audion tube is a triode vacuum tube that amplifies electrical signals. De Forest added a third electrode, known as the grid, to John Ambrose Fleming’s original diode vacuum tube design. This addition allowed for more precise control over the flow of electrons, leading to significant advancements in telegraphy and wireless communication.

One of the most important contributions of the audion tube was its ability to amplify weak signals. Prior to its invention, long-distance communication was limited by signal degradation over vast distances. With the audion tube acting as an amplifier, these weak signals could be strengthened before being transmitted further down the line. This breakthrough opened up new possibilities for long-range wireless communication.
